Просмотр исходного кода

Pamels: Options are always there

Torkel Ödegaard 6 лет назад
Родитель
Сommit
f4f5eeeb18
1 измененных файлов с 6 добавлено и 8 удалено
  1. 6 8
      public/app/plugins/panel/singlestat2/module.tsx

+ 6 - 8
public/app/plugins/panel/singlestat2/module.tsx

@@ -9,15 +9,13 @@ const optionsToKeep = ['valueOptions', 'stat', 'maxValue', 'maxValue', 'threshol
 export const singleStatBaseOptionsCheck = (
   options: Partial<SingleStatBaseOptions>,
   prevPluginId: string,
-  prevOptions?: any
+  prevOptions: any
 ) => {
-  if (prevOptions) {
-    optionsToKeep.forEach(v => {
-      if (prevOptions.hasOwnProperty(v)) {
-        options[v] = cloneDeep(prevOptions.display);
-      }
-    });
-  }
+  optionsToKeep.forEach(v => {
+    if (prevOptions.hasOwnProperty(v)) {
+      options[v] = cloneDeep(prevOptions.display);
+    }
+  });
   return options;
 };